    Before hooking up too much equipment, I'd verify the operation of that panel. I would connect an appropriate dummy load
    to each of the 12 rows, and with steady sun, they should each produce about the same voltage & current. These are the
    same points to which you might be attaching bypass diodes later.

    My own DIY panel attempts, even with cells pre tested, sometimes would end up with faulty cells. These can be shorted or
    otherwise wired out to let the rest function best. good luck, Bruce Roe
